Output 288865b7e6aa875805e2d8485a049c21389a161807f1cd98d2de0833e278b915:3

value
15081255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96c3820677252ec244e73e9afe23b4983685f719 OP_EQUAL
address
3FSBVSq2syqcp4WZZR3NHBjwCskA9JMKB3
transaction
288865b7e6aa875805e2d8485a049c21389a161807f1cd98d2de0833e278b915
spent
true